Hi,
With a 5m, 2 story brick house to maintain and some long ladders to do it, I use as much protection as I can.
The brickie left ventilation gaps at a convenient level, so I made up some steel strap that locks into the gap and I ratchet strap the ladder out either side to these.
Rock solid!
Using 2 ladders and a plank on a rig I made similar to one I saw a sign writer use, I can cover most of the windows, eaves etc quite easily.
The safety takes longer to set up but it is better than falling.
